Opinion polls by two major U.S. television networks show that the majority of the country’s citizens have faith in President Barack Obama’s ability to protect them from ”future acts of terrorism”.
The survey results come despite a wave of strong criticism of the administration’s conduct following the recent failed attempt by a Nigerian national, Umar Farouk Abdul Mutallab, to blow up a flight from Amsterdam to the U.S. city of Detroit.
A CNN poll released on Jan. 11 shows that 65 percent of the 1,025 respondents said they had either a ”great deal of” or ”moderate” confidence in Obama administration to keep them safe from future attacks. The number is six points higher than a similar CNN poll in August 2006 when President George W. Bush was in the White House.
